Pacers' averages in Test debuts away from home since 2000:
In Australia: 68.54 (Bowling S/R of 102)
In SL: 50.5
In India: 45.4
In NZ: 40.84
In WI: 39.85
In ENG: 32.56
In SA: 31.23
In BAN: 30.46
In ZIM: 25.45

Interesting to note that 23 away pacers have made their debuts in Australia, easily the highest amongst all countries - an indication of how teams get so easily disheveled in Australia/ how they fast track their promising pacers but end up on the wrong side so often.
Baptism by fire for whoever out of Saini/Siraj gets to make their Test debut.
And what a debut it was by Siraj! (5/77 off 36.3 overs)
Best debut performance in AUS (in terms of bowling average) by an opposition pacer in a winning cause in Test history. And the second-best overall after Malinga's 6/92 in 2004. Siraj's E/R of 2.10 also equally impressive.
